Ja Morant has provided the Grizzlies with a renewed belief

The Memphis Grizzlies are 4-0 since Ja Morant returned from his 25-game suspension. The All-Star guard has immediately impacted his team's performances, especially on the offensive end. 

According to Antonio Daniels, who spent 13 years in the NBA and was speaking via a recent episode of "NBA Dash Radio" on SiriusXM, Morant has given the Grizzlies a renewed belief.

"You start looking to bigger and better things," Daniels said. "They're a completely different team with him, man. Just the confidence, the swagger that he plays with. It wasn't there when they were 6-19. ... One player makes a huge difference in this league, and when you get that guy back, it's almost like a jolt of energy, of confidence, of belief, of hope. ... It's like they're going into games now, and they feel like they can win every game because Ja Morant is present." 

Morant is averaging 28.8 points, 5.3 rebounds and 8.5 assists, shooting 50.6% from the field and 16.7% from three-point range in the four games since his return to the rotation. 

His energy and explosivness have been infectious throughout the locker room. Memphis looks like a team that suddenly believes they can turn their season around. 

Marcus Smart returned from injury on Tuesday and helped the Grizzlies secure an overtime win over the New Orleans Pelicans. Derrick Rose is expected to return to the rotation in the near future and Brandon Clarke should be ready to play before the end of February

After months of struggling, the Grizzlies are finally getting healthy. 

Sitting 13th in the Western Conference, the Grizzlies still have an opportunity to climb the ladder and secure a spot in the playoffs or the play-in tournament. 

Morant's return has helped breathe a newfound belief into Taylor Jenkins' team. If he can stay injury-free and avoid any more missteps, Morant could be an incredible catalyst over the coming months, which is a credit to the level of talent he brings to the table.
